KVM: VMX: simplify invpcid handling in vmx_cpuid_update()
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
If vmx_invpcid_supported() is true, second execution control
filed must be supported and SECONDARY_EXEC_ENABLE_INVPCID
must have already been set in current vmcs by
vmx_secondary_exec_control()

If vmx_invpcid_supported() is false, no need to clear
SECONDARY_EXEC_ENABLE_INVPCID
